Open the catalog to page 2High-Efficiency Energy-Saving Drying The FR series is an advanced continuous cycle dryer solution designed to optimise fuel consumption on any size of processing volume. Thanks to an innovative recovery fan system, these systems maximise energy efficiency, significantly reducing operating costs and environmental impact. The load-bearing frame is made of hot-dip galvanised structural steel, qualified and tested for the various conditions of use. Open the catalog to page 4Energy-saving drying MAXIMUM EFFICIENCY IN AIR RECIRCULATION The efficiency of FR dryers comes from optimising the drying process. Unlike conventional systems, hot air that is not completely saturated with moisture is not expelled but recovered in the lower section. Here it mixes with the hot air from the generator, creating a virtuous cycle of heat recovery. This process optimises energy efficiency, with a significant reduction in fuel consumption.
